An Afghan role-player awaits patrolling Marines inside Camp Pendleton’s Infantry Immersion Trainer, April 7. The 32,000-square-foot military urban training facility was recently changed from a simulated Iraqi village, to resemble the Afghan village of Now Zad, after Headquarters Marine Corps officials made the decision March 15, to modify the training environment.
